来源:wenku7.com 资料编号:WK717254 资料等级:★★★★★ %E8%B5%84%E6%96%99%E7%BC%96%E5%8F%B7%EF%BC%9AWK717254
2.资料以网页介绍的为准,下载后不会有水印.资料仅供学习参考之用. 密 保 惠 帮助
摘 要
关键词:单片机 土壤湿度测量 温度测量 自动浇水
Design of flowerpots automatic watering system based on Microcontroller
With the continuous development of social technology and economic level continues to improve, various household equipment trend to the development of humane and intelligent direction. Intelligent flowerpot watering systems can greatly reduce the work of people watering the flower, while ensuring plant life in good condition, and it also is a part of the intelligent home devices.
The intelligent watering system measure soil moisture and temperature at regular intervals. When the humidity is too low, it will start watering function. It send an warning message to warn people to add water into a water tank if the tank have no water. If the temperature is too high, it will issue a message to warn people to put it to more cool place. The system uses Microcontroller SST89E58 as the control chip and the core is the smallest single-chip system. It composed by measurement module of soil moisture using TLC1549 AD converter chip, temperature measurement module using a DS18B20 chip, a LCD using ILI9325 and XPT2046 chip, watering module using a DC motor and water level alarm module and other peripheral circuits. The system design include acquisition of soil moisture and temperature, displaying system status information, control the pump, alarm module of tank level, wireless communication between lower machine and PC and PC display interface design. At the same time, the system displays information to the LCD and sent the related information to the host computer through the wireless module, and the host computer record historical data.
Key Words: Microcontroller; Soil moisture measurement; Temperature measurement;
Automatic watering

目 录
摘 要 I
Abstract II
第一章 绪 论 1
1.1 课题研究的背景 1
1.2 论文所做的工作 2
第二章 系统设计概述 3
2.1 系统的内容和要求 3
2.2 系统的方案选择 3
2.2.1系统显示设计方案 3
2.2.2 湿度测量设计方案 4
2.2.3 温度测量设计方案 4
2.2.4 水位报警设计方案 5
第三章 硬件系统设计 6
3.1 硬件系统框图 6
3.2 单片机最小系统 6
3.3 湿度测量模块 8
3.4 温度测量模块 10
3.6 水位报警模块 11
3.7 显示模块 12
3.7.1 ILI9325显示模块 12
3.7.2 XPT2046触摸模块 13
第四章 软件设计 15
4.1 主程序 15
4.2 土壤湿度程序 16
4.3 温度测量程序 19
4.4 LCD显示程序 20
4.5 触摸屏程序 21
4.6 上位机程序 22
第五章 系统调试 24
结束语 26
参考文献 27
致谢 28
附录一 系统电路图 29
附录二 上位机程序设计 30
附录三 下位机程序设计 33